Mountaintop removal mining (MTR), also known as mountaintop mining (MTM), is a form of surface mining that involves the topographical alteration and/or removal of a summit, hill, or ridge to access buried coal seams.. The MTR process involves the removal of coal seams by first fully removing the overburden lying atop them, exposing the seams from above.

As the depth of the coal seam increases, so does the pressure level. This in turn reduces the level of permeability, causing the methane to be much more tightly bound to the coal and surrounding rock strata. Underground mining can therefore produce substantially greater levels of methane than surface mining.

Mar 01, 2014· Local groups have generally advocated for greater awareness about coal mining''s health impacts in three ways: community education, policy work, and direct action. In 2013, OVEC partnered with the Southern Appalachian Labor School to host a series of public meetings in Fayette County,, to educate people about the impacts of coal mining.

Coal mining is only a temporary use of land, so it is vital that rehabilitation of land takes place once mining operations have stopped. In best practice a detailed rehabilitation or reclamation plan is designed and approved for each coal mine, covering the period from the start of operations until well after mining .

Mining is the extraction of valuable minerals or other geological materials from the Earth, usually from an ore body, lode, vein, seam, reef or placer deposits form a mineralized package that is of economic interest to the miner. Ores recovered by mining include metals, coal, oil shale, gemstones, limestone, chalk, dimension stone, rock salt, potash, gravel, and clay.
